Founded in 2022, the Arista Institute is a collaboration between the Faculty of Engineering Sciences and the Faculty of Arts and Humanities. The Institute is directed by Prof Maurice Biriotti and Prof Ruth Morgan.
We address persistent, complex, dynamic challenges using creative interdisciplinary thinking. We make connections across disciplines and with industry, government, and the third sector. We find unconventional intersections and reimagine environmentally and economically sustainable solutions.
